The Potential of Common Cereals to form Retrograded Resistant Starch
Resistant starch (RS) has been recognised as a functional fibre with many health-promoting effects. RS exists in four forms - RS1, RS2, RS3, and RS4. The RS3 type is generated by amylose retrogradation typically resulting from food processing procedures.

This study reveals how the mitochondrial protein Slm35 is regulated in Saccharomyces cerevisiae. The authors identify stress‐responsive DNA elements and two upstream open reading frames (uORFs) in the 5′ untranslated region of SLM35. One uORF restricts translation, and its mutation increases Slm35 protein levels and mitophagy.
